Türkçe - İngilizce
ersatz
: Something made in imitation; an effigy or substitute
literally "inferior substitute", the 222 measurement sites in the 1952-1975 SOLMET/ERSATZ solar & meteorological hourly network that did not measure solar radiation The solar radiation for these sites was modeled from cloud cover data and other information The SOLMET/ERSATZ network has been replaced by the 1961-1990 National Solar Radiation Data Base
substitute
Made in imitation; artificial, especially of an inferior quality
{s} used in place of, substitute
disapproval If you describe something as ersatz, you dislike it because it is not genuine and is a poor imitation of something better. an ersatz Victorian shopping precinct = fake. artificial, and not as good as the real thing
{i} substitute, replacement
an artificial or inferior substitute or imitation
an artificial or inferior substitute or imitation artificial and inferior; "ersatz coffee"; "substitute coffee
(German) Substitute As a rule, the term implies that the Ersatz is inferior to the article for which it is a substitute B 24
artificial and inferior; "ersatz coffee"; "substitute coffee"
\AIR-sahts; UR-sats\, adjective: Being a substitute or imitation, usually an inferior one
